public interface OrderedLongIterable extends LongIterable
| Modifier and Type | Method and Description |
|---|---|
<V> OrderedIterable<V> |
collect(LongToObjectFunction<? extends V> function)
Returns a new collection with the results of applying the specified function on each element of the source
collection.
|
default <V> OrderedIterable<V> |
collectWithIndex(LongIntToObjectFunction<? extends V> function)
Returns a new OrderedIterable using results obtained by applying the specified function to each element
and its corresponding index.
|
default <V,R extends Collection<V>> |
collectWithIndex(LongIntToObjectFunction<? extends V> function,
R target)
Adds elements to the target Collection using results obtained by applying the specified function to each element
and its corresponding index.
|
void |
forEachWithIndex(LongIntProcedure procedure) |
long |
getFirst() |
int |
indexOf(long value) |
<T> T |
injectIntoWithIndex(T injectedValue,
ObjectLongIntToObjectFunction<? super T,? extends T> function) |
OrderedLongIterable |
reject(LongPredicate predicate)
Returns a new LongIterable with all of the elements in the LongIterable that
return false for the specified predicate.
|
default OrderedLongIterable |
rejectWithIndex(LongIntPredicate predicate)
Returns a new OrderedLongIterable excluding all elements with corresponding indexes matching the specified predicate.
|
default <R extends MutableLongCollection> |
rejectWithIndex(LongIntPredicate predicate,
R target)
Returns a new MutableLongCollection excluding all elements with corresponding indexes matching the specified predicate.
|
OrderedLongIterable |
select(LongPredicate predicate)
Returns a new LongIterable with all of the elements in the LongIterable that
return true for the specified predicate.
|
default OrderedLongIterable |
selectWithIndex(LongIntPredicate predicate)
Returns a new OrderedLongIterable including all elements with corresponding indexes matching the specified predicate.
|
default <R extends MutableLongCollection> |
selectWithIndex(LongIntPredicate predicate,
R target)
Returns a new MutableLongCollection including all elements with corresponding indexes matching the specified predicate.
|
